I recently switched back to the mac os after 9 years on windows. The only thing that bothers me is the switch of the command and control key functions. Not only are my fingers more used to control c control v, I think it is easier for the hand to make that key combination.

Is there anyway to switch the mac os to use control c and control v for copy and paste?

It would be even better if I could switch it globally so all apps, including adobe's apps would just reverse the two keys.

Using the command key is a lot easier because you use your thumb as opposed your little finger.

However you can switch the keys over:
1. Go to your system preferences
2. Click on keyboard and mouse
3. Click on keyboard.
4. click on modifier keys

OR you can just do a spotlight search for modifier keys
